4.3 Wiring the F220-B6R
The F220-B6R is the standard base for four-wire
configurations. The Alarm Loop Relay (terminals NO
and C) is a normally open relay rated 0.5 A use at
100 VDC. The relay closes on alarm.
Table 5: F220-B6R Terminal Functions
(see Figure 6)
DCIN/OUT
a1/a2
DC + IN b1
DC + OUT b2
Remote LED output c
Alarm Contact NO (Terminal 1)
Alarm Relay C (Terminal 2)
4.4 Wiring the F220-B6C
The F220-B6C base has a normally open alarm loop
relay and auxiliary Form C (NC/C/NO) contacts.
The contacts are rated 0.5 A use at 125 VAC and 1.0 A
use at 30 VDC for resistive loads. Do not use with
inductive or capacitive loads.
Table 6: F220-B6C terminal functions
(see Figure 7)
DCIN/OUT
a1/a2
DC + IN b1
DC + OUT b2
Remote LED output c
Auxiliary Form C NC (Terminal 1)
Auxiliary Form C C (Terminal 2)
Auxiliary Form C NO (Terminal 3)
Alarm Relay Form A C (Terminal 4)
Alarm Relay Form A NO (Terminal 5)

4.5 Wiring the F220-B6E
The F220-B6E base has a normally open alarm loop
relay and an auxiliary set of normally open contacts.
The contacts are rated 0.5 A use at 125 VAC and 1.0 A
use at 30 VDC for resistive loads. Do not use with
inductive or capacitive loads.
The F220-B6E base also provides EOL power
supervision through a built in relay. Separate power
supervision devices, such as the D275, are unnecessary.
Use only one F220-B6E per zone run. It must be the
last base on the run.
The EOL Relay is rated 0.5 A use at 100 VDC for
resistive loads.
Table 7: F220-B6E terminal functions
(see Figure 8)
DCIN/OUT
a1/a2
DC + IN b1
DC + OUT b2
Remote LED output c
Alarm Form A NO (Terminal 1)
Alarm Relay Form A C (Terminal 2)
EOL Relay Form A NO (Terminal 3)
EOL Relay Form A C (Terminal 4)
(Terminal 5) Not connected
